HIPAA and Social Media: 5 Tips to Stay Compliant

Hootsuite

However, social media is subject to the Privacy Rule. Source: CDC That means organizations covered by HIPAA cannot publish or share any protected health information on social media without the relevant individual’s specific, written authorization.
